Transfer News: Chelsea resolved to sign West Ham midfielder this mid year

The Blues are purportedly resolved to sign West Ham United midfielder Declan Rice this summer.

Chelsea have just spent vigorously in the current transfer market, signing Timo Werner, Hakim Ziyech and Ben Chilwell ahead of the 2020-21 season.

Kai Havertz is also expected to arrive in a major movey move from Bayer Leverkusen, while Malang Sarr and Thiago Silva have joined the West London club on free transfers.

However, as per report, Chelsea remain determined on signing Declan Rice, who is accepted to be valued by West Ham around £80m.

The report guarantees that Chelsea are in no quick rush for the West Ham midfielder but are interested to secure a deal before the transfer deadline toward the beginning of October.

Declan Rice scored once and gave three assists in 38 appearances for the Hammers last season.
